Friedrich Wilhelm Ritschl: copies of Latin inscriptions and a list of coins and a catalogue of pamphlets

Title Friedrich Wilhelm Ritschl: copies of Latin inscriptions and a list of coins and a catalogue of pamphlets
Reference GBR/0012/MS Add.4012-4018, MS Add.5971-5975, MS Add.6285
Creator Ritschl, Friedrich Wilhelm (1806-1876), classical scholar
Covering Dates 1850–1865
Extent and Medium 13 Volumes
Repository Cambridge University Library, Department of Manuscripts and University Archives
Content and context

Friedrich Wilhelm Ritschl (1806-1876), classical scholar, was born on 6 April 1806. He entered Leipzig University in 1825, before transferring to Halle the following year. He began his professional career at Halle, removing thereafter to Breslau, then Bonn, where he founded the school of classical scholarship. He became a professor at Leipzig in 1865, where he died on 9 November 1876. Ritschl was a specialist on Plautus, and produced works on Greek and Roman writers.

The inscriptions are arranged chronologically and include references to printed editions. The versos are blank throughout.

MSS.Add.5971-5975 and 6285 were purchased with the Ritschl collection, 1878. There is no record of accession for MSS.Add.4012-4018. These volumes were possibly received with the Ritschl collection.
